WordNet (3.0)
whitsun(n) Christian holiday; the week beginning on Whitsunday (especially the first 3 days), Syn. Whitsuntide, Whitweek

The Collaborative International Dictionary of English (GCIDE) v.0.53
Whitsun

a. Of, pertaining to, or observed at, Whitsuntide; as, Whitsun week; Whitsun Tuesday; Whitsun pastorals. [ 1913 Webster ]

Whitsunday

n. [ White + Sunday. ] 1. (Eccl.) The seventh Sunday, and the fiftieth day, after Easter; a festival of the church in commemoration of the descent of the Holy Spirit on the day of Pentecost; Pentecost; -- so called, it is said, because, in the primitive church, those who had been newly baptized appeared at church between Easter and Pentecost in white garments. [ 1913 Webster ]

2. (Scots Law) See the Note under Term, n., 12. [ 1913 Webster ]

Whitsuntide

n. [ Whitsunday + tide. ] The week commencing with Whitsunday, esp. the first three days -- Whitsunday, Whitsun Monday, and Whitsun Tuesday; the time of Pentecost. R. of Gloucester. [ 1913 Webster ]
